
The correct rim size for your car is determined by several factors beyond just diameter. The most accurate way is to check your vehicle's doorjamb sticker, owner's manual, or the specifications on the sidewall of your current tires. For example, a marking like "P225/65R17" indicates a 17-inch rim diameter. However, you must also match the bolt pattern, offset, and wheel width to ensure safety and proper handling.
Mismatched rims can cause vibration, premature tire wear, and damage to suspension components. The bolt pattern (e.g., 5x114.3, meaning 5 bolts on a 114.3mm circle) must be exact. The offset is the distance from the wheel's centerline to the mounting surface; an incorrect offset can make the wheel rub against the fender or suspension.
| Vehicle Type | Common Rim Sizes | Typical Bolt Pattern | Key Consideration |
|---|---|---|---|
| Compact Sedan (e.g., Civic) | 16", 17", 18" | 5x114.3 | Staying close to factory offset avoids handling issues. |
| Full-Size Truck (e.g., Ford F-150) | 17", 18", 20" | 6x135 | High load rating is critical for towing and payload. |
| Performance Coupe (e.g., Ford Mustang) | 19", 20", 21" | 5x114.3 | Wider rims improve grip but can reduce ride comfort. |
| SUV (e.g., Toyota RAV4) | 17", 18", 19" | 5x114.3 | Larger diameters may compromise off-road tire sidewall height. |
For a guaranteed fit, use an online fitment guide from a major tire retailer. You enter your vehicle's year, make, and model, and it shows all compatible rim sizes and configurations. This is safer than guessing, as it accounts for all the technical specifications unique to your car.

Check the inside of your driver's side door. There's a sticker with all the tire and rim info you need. It'll list the factory size, like "18x7.5J," which is the diameter and width. That's your starting point. You can go a bit bigger or smaller, but you have to make sure the new rims have the same number of bolts and that they line up exactly. Getting it wrong is an expensive mistake. Stick close to the original specs for the best results.

As someone who's swapped rims on a few of my own cars, the devil is in the details. The diameter is just the beginning. You need to know your car's bolt pattern and offset. The offset is huge—it determines how far the wheel sits in or out of the wheel well. Too far out and it'll rub the fender when you turn; too far in and it might hit the suspension. I always use a trusted online fitment tool or consult with a specialty wheel shop. They can simulate the fit before you buy.

Think about what you use your car for. If it's a commuter car, sticking with the standard rim size is your best bet for a smooth ride and good fuel economy. Putting massive rims on a family SUV might look cool, but the low-profile tires that come with them often make the ride harsh and are more prone to damage from potholes. If you have a truck for hauling, the rim's load rating is non-negotiable. Always prioritize how the change will affect your daily drive, not just the looks.

Don't forget about your tire pressure monitoring system (TPMS). If your car was made in the last 15 years or so, it has sensors in the wheels. When you get new rims, you'll need to have these sensors transferred over or new ones installed. Otherwise, you'll have a warning light on your dashboard all the time. Also, after you put new wheels on, a professional alignment is a really good idea. This ensures everything is calibrated correctly, preventing your new tires from wearing out unevenly. It’s an extra step, but it protects your investment.
